BURNSVILLE, Minn. – Southwest Minnesota State softball pitcher
Jordyn Marsh was named NSIC Pitcher of the Week, with an announcement coming from the league office Monday afternoon.
Marsh, a sophomore from New Prague, Minn., earned a 3-0 record over the weekend against Northern State and Jamestown, and in 14 innings of work did not allow a run.
Against the Wolves on Friday, Marsh pitched three innings in game one, earning the win while allowing one hit with four strikeouts. In game two, Marsh pitched all five innings, allowing just two hits with two strikeouts.
Marsh started game one against Jamestown on Saturday, pitching all five innings and allowing two hits with four strikeouts. She pitched the final inning of game two, capping her weekend off with another strikeout.
This is the first Pitcher of the Week award for Marsh in her career, and the second Player of the Week award for the Mustangs this season (
Emma Humpal, Feb. 17). SMSU, 29-23 overall, 15-11 NSIC, finishes the regular season this weekend in North Dakota, facing Minot State on Saturday, May 2, and UMary the following afternoon.
